Is anyone like me?
Hello Her2 sisters. I was just wondering if anyone has a similar pathology as me since I don't fit into too many categories. I am just at the cut-off of suggested chemo/herceptin since I am Triple positive, node negative, with an invasive tumor of 6mm. Can anyone share their treatment experience with a tumor less than 1 cm? Did you have four cycles as opposed to six cycles of chemo? Thanks!

My IDC was similar in size and after looking at all the variables my MO recommended 8 cycles of dose dense AC/T plus Herceptin. I think it's a hard call with tiny tumors.

Hey there. I had a small tumor and had weekly Taxol and Herceptin. I just finished rads and will have Herceptin every 3 weeks till February.

Hi Deaconlady. How did you handle the Taxol? I start next week and I know everyone has a different reaction but my doctor said other than the loss of hair, the fatigue is the main complaint. Thanks!!!!
Kdlee, I had a port inserted too. Unfortunately, they have to go back in and reinsert it this week. I am a very rare case of a port shifting! I still can't believe it but I got to do what I have to do to get this going!
-
HI Cwhitney! Taxol wasn't bad at all for me, but I see that you have AC too. My hair thinned some, but didn't completely fall out. I actually have lost some eyelashes and eyebrows on one side only now! I was tired some, but still worked through. I just napped on weekends when I could. I had a little nausea from time to time, and a little neuropathy. However, the side effects were not that bad at all.
